How much do financial operations j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 29, 2026, the average yearly pay for financial operations in Utah is $105,475.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$80,600.00 and $125,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is financial operations?

Financial operations refer to the processes and activities involved in managing a company's financial resources, including tasks such as budgeting, accounting, financial reporting, cash flow management, and compliance. Professionals in financial operations ensure that all financial transactions are accurately recorded and that the organization adheres to financial regulations and policies. Their work helps businesses maintain financial health, make informed decisions, and achieve their strategic goals. Financial operations roles can exist in various industries and often collaborate closely with other departments such as finance, accounting, and management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in financial operations, and why are they important?

To thrive in Financial Operations,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a solid understanding of accounting principles, usually supported by a degree in finance, accounting, or a related field. Famil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, financial reporting tools, and certifications like CPA or CFA are often required. Effective communication, problem-solving abilities, and organizational skills help professionals excel in cross-functional teams and manage complex transactions. These skills and qualifications are vital for ensuring accurate financial management, compliance, and efficient business operations.

What are some common challenges faced in a financial operations role, and how can they be addressed?

One common challenge in Financial Operations is managing tight deadlines while ensuring accuracy in financial reporting and transaction processing. Team members often handle large volumes of data and must reconcile discrepancies quickly to support organizational decision-making. Effective communication with cross-functional teams, such as accounting and compliance, is crucial to resolving issues promptly. Utilizing automation tools and maintaining strong attention to detail help mitigate errors and streamline workflow, making it easier to meet demanding timelines.

What is the difference between Financial Operations vs Financial Analyst?

AspectFinancial OperationsFinancial Analyst
Primary FocusManaging financial processes, transactions, and reporting systemsAnalyzing financial data, trends, and investment opportunities
Required SkillsAccounting, financial systems, complianceFinancial modeling, data analysis, forecasting
Work EnvironmentFinance departments, accounting teamsInvestment firms, corporate finance, consulting
CertificationsCPA, CFA (optional), CPA preferredCFA, CPA, or related certifications often preferred

Financial Operations primarily handles the day-to-day financial processes and reporting within an organization, ensuring accuracy and compliance. In contrast, a Financial Analyst focuses on analyzing financial data to support decision-making and strategic planning. Both roles require strong financial knowledge and certifications like CPA or CFA, but their core responsibilities and work environments differ significantly.

The role:
We are seeking a Manager, Financial Operations to lead a high-performing operations team responsible for critical financial workflows, reconciliation activities, ticket resolution, and data quality improvements. This role will oversee both an established FinOps team and a newly integrated group of reconciliation specialists, ensuring accurate execution, strong controls, effective cross-functional partnership, and continuous improvement across key operational processes. The Manager, Financial Operations will be responsible for leading day-to-day execution while also identifying opportunities to improve processes, strengthen controls, increase automation, and scale the team's impact. This role will also serve as a trusted operational point of contact for client and bank partners, ensuring clear communication, effective expectation management, and timely follow-through on issues, requests, and escalations. This is a hands-on leadership role for someone who is comfortable working across detailed operational workflows, complex data sets, technical partners, external stakeholders, and evolving business priorities.
What you'll do:
  • Lead the Financial Operations team responsible for managing support tickets, creating QMR/GOC network reporting, resolving operational issues, and supporting timely execution of financial operations workflows.
  • Manage and develop reconciliation specialists responsible for Settlement reporting reconciliation, Money Movement approvals, Cobrand FBO reconciliation review, suspense reconciliation, and Billpay-related operational activities.
  • Support EPD and other cross-functional partners by driving improvements to network data quality, operational data integrity, and issue resolution processes.
  • Provide day-to-day leadership, coaching, prioritization, and performance management for team members across multiple financial operations functions.
  • Establish clear operating rhythms, service levels, escalation paths, and quality expectations for ticket management, reconciliation review, approvals, and issue resolution.
  • Partner with Product, Engineering, Data, Finance, Accounting, Compliance, Risk, Operations, client, and bank partner teams to investigate issues, improve workflows, and support scalable operational solutions.
  • Serve as a professional operational liaison for client and bank partners by communicating status, clarifying requirements, managing expectations, and coordinating timely resolution of issues and escalations.
  • Use SQL and data analysis to research issues, validate transactions, identify trends, support reconciliations, and drive root cause analysis.
  • Strengthen controls and documentation across reconciliation processes, approval workflows, suspense management, and financial operations support activities.
  • Identify opportunities to reduce manual work, improve accuracy, increase automation, and enhance operational visibility through reporting and process redesign.
  • Monitor team performance, operational metrics, aging items, exception volumes, and recurring issue patterns to support proactive management and continuous improvement.
  • Translate complex operational issues into clear business impacts, recommendations, and action plans for leadership and cross-functional stakeholders.
  • Help integrate new responsibilities, processes, and team members into the broader Financial Operations function while maintaining execution quality and business continuity.

What you'll need:
  • Experience leading financial operations, reconciliation, banking operations, payments operations, card operations, or similar operational teams.
  • Proven people leadership skills, including coaching, prioritization, accountability, performance management, and team development.
  • Strong understanding of reconciliation workflows, exception management, operational controls, approvals, and issue resolution processes.
  • Hands-on SQL skills with the ability to query data, investigate exceptions, validate results, and support operational decision-making.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to identify root causes, evaluate operational risk, and recommend practical solutions.
  • Strategic thinking and process improvement mindset, including experience improving workflows, documentation, controls, reporting, or automation.
  • Ability to operate effectively in a fast-paced environment with competing priorities, evolving processes, and cross-functional dependencies.
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ills, including the ability to explain complex operational and data issues clearly to technical, non-technical, client, and bank partner audiences.
  • Strong attention to detail and commitment to accuracy, timeliness, and operational excellence.
  • Ability to balance hands-on execution with team leadership, stakeholder management, and longer-term operational transformation.
